The ingredients needed to make Easy peasy leftovers pasta salad:
- Get salad
- Get 4 cup cooked bow tie pasta
- Take 3 cup fresh broccoli florets
- Prepare 2 cup leftover chicken, cut into small cubes, you can be very versatile here by using leftover turkey or ham.
- Prepare 1 cup roasted cherry tomatoes, recipe is in my profile.
- Prepare 2 slice cooked bacon, crumbled
- Prepare 1/2 cup mozzerella cheese cut into cubes
- Get 1/2 cup Italian dressing, store bought or home made

Steps to make Easy peasy leftovers pasta salad:
- In a large bowl mix all ingredients together. Transfer to a serving dish and simply enjoy!
